基于改进遗传算法的毫米波功率分配器设计

摘    要:高效宽带功率分配器是高功率毫米波合成放大器设计成功的关键环节。为缩短产品研制周期、降低成本和提高质量,电路的优化设计日益受到人们的关注。文中引入均匀设计理论,并与改进遗传算法相结合,优化设计了一种基于鳍线的毫米波二路功率分配器。测试结果与仿真结果吻合较好,从而验证了该算法的准确性和有效性.

Abstract:High-efficiency power-dividers with broad bandwidth are essential for millimeter-wave high power-amplifier (PA) modules. The optimized circuit design could reduce the product development period, lower the product cost and raise the product, thus has attracted much attention from the people. By introducing the uniform design theory and combining with the genetic algorithms, a finline-based two-way power-divider at millimeter-wave frequencies is optimally designed and developed. The identity of simulation results and experiment results indicates that this method is accurate, feasible and effective.
